[NOUN]What is "cream cheese"?
Cream cheese is a smooth and creamy spread made from fresh milk and cream. It has a mild and slightly tangy flavor, making it versatile in both sweet and savory dishes. Cream cheese is commonly used as a spread on bagels, toast, or crackers, and it serves as a key ingredient in various recipes like cheesecakes, frosting, and dips. Its creamy texture and rich taste add a delightful touch to both baked goods and savory dishes, making it a beloved ingredient in many cuisines around the world.
